Many public services are subject to the problems associated with the lack of size of the administrative territory and the cooperation of the municipalities is the option of how to resolve these issues. Intermunicipal cooperation thanks to economies of scale is one of the municipal choices how to save costs and increase efficiency issued by public funds. The aim of this paper is to evaluate whether the intermunicipal cooperation affects the municipal waste management expenditure or greater impact on cost-effectiveness have other factors associated with it like: a form of cooperation, management of the waste collection company, number of municipalities involved in cooperation and the size of the waste collection territory. The South Moravia region was chosen as the sample for the evaluation due to the fact that the municipalities cooperate in waste management most of all regions and also the longest and as the method was chosen OLS regression. The analysis was performed for 668 municipalities in 2014. The results of the research have shown that the intermunicipal cooperation is actually very important factor of cost-effectiveness, but results have also shown that institutionalization of cooperation is important and unexpectedly of the influence of big city on waste collection company management has been noted as very important factor.
